Precept Adds Hybrid Set for Women, the ECW Hybrid Irons

By Brent Kelley, About.com

Sep 22 2004
After consulting with leading experts in women's golf, Precept is launching a new set of hybrid irons for women, the ECW Hybrid set.

The Precept ECW Hybrid set is a combination of utility woods and irons the Precept designed to address two key issues: clubhead speed and launch angle. Typically, women golfers tend to have slower clubhead speeds and, consequently, lower launch angles. Precept reasoned that the ideal equipment for women needed to offer them distance and the ability to get the ball airborne. But, the company said, since women play differently than men, there was no reason to follow the traditional set makeup.

So Precept created a mixture of utility woods and scoring irons that the company believes will help women elevate their game.

The ECW Hybrid set starts with two utility woods, the 3/4 (25 degrees of loft) and the 5/6 (30 degrees of loft). These two utility woods incorporate tungsten weights in the clubs to reposition the center of gravity such that they are easier to hit than long irons. The utility clubs should, Precept says, help women get the ball airborne from a wider variety of lies. An elastomer compound insert inside the woods' clubheads is designed to help stabilize the clubhead for more solid shots, even on mis-hits.

The themes of playability and forgiveness carry over to the irons, which fill out the set (7-SW). The irons feature a longer heel-to-toe length for added forgiveness, tungsten weighting in the trailing edge to help get the ball in the air and elastomer compound inserts to reduce vibration and provide more feel.

The Precept ECW Hybrid set comes equipped with a 57-gram, L-flex high modulus carbon graphite shaft, a lightweight shaft designed specifically for lower clubhead speeds. The ECW Hybrid set features a blue/white color scheme.

The Precept ECW Hybrid set carries at MSRP at launch of $600.
